Oct. 11 (Bloomberg) -- Sovereign Bancorp Inc. Chief Executive Officer Jay Sidhu resigned after one 17-month feud with some of the Philadelphia-based company's biggest investors. Sovereign named Joseph Campanelli, who previously served as vice chairman and also head of Sovereign's New England unit, to replace Sidhu as president and CEO, the bank said in one statement today. Sidhu will serve as non-executive chairman until Dec. 31. ... |

The first thing you notice about little Jonathan Steele is his stunning hazel eyes — eyes that his family says change color depending on his mood or what he is wearing. The second thing you notice is the plastic device attached to his throat, which allows the 19-month-old to breathe. Jonathan was born 13 weeks premature and has spent most of his young life in the hospital. On Oct. 18, he faces his fourth major surgery to help him breathe without assistance. ... |
